Sourcing guidance for Boiler Nozzle

What are the key technical specifications to consider when selecting a boiler nozzle?

When sourcing boiler nozzles, you must prioritize material composition and spray patterns. High-quality nozzles are typically made from 310S stainless steel, silicon carbide, or high-nickel alloys to withstand extreme temperatures and corrosive environments. You should verify the spray angle (typically 30° to 90°) and the flow rate (GPH) to ensure compatibility with your specific boiler model. Additionally, check for precision machining tolerances to prevent uneven fuel atomization, which can lead to carbon buildup and reduced thermal efficiency.

Which compliance standards and certifications are mandatory for industrial boiler components?

Safety is paramount in pressure-vessel components. Ensure the supplier complies with ASME (American Society of Mechanical Engineers) standards, specifically Section I for Power Boilers. For the European market, CE marking and PED (Pressure Equipment Directive) 2014/68/EU compliance is essential. Furthermore, look for ISO 9001:2015 certification to guarantee that the manufacturer maintains a consistent quality management system for precision-engineered parts.

How does the nozzle design impact fuel efficiency and emissions?

The nozzle's atomization capability directly influences combustion efficiency. A high-performance nozzle ensures a fine and uniform droplet size, which promotes complete combustion and reduces NOx and CO emissions. For heavy oil applications, look for internal-mix steam or air-atomizing nozzles that can handle higher viscosities. Choosing the correct nozzle tip geometry can reduce fuel consumption by up to 5-10% compared to worn or poorly calibrated components.

What are the typical usage scenarios and maintenance requirements for these nozzles?

Boiler nozzles are critical in industrial steam generation, power plants, and HVAC systems. Due to high-velocity fluid flow, they are prone to erosion and clogging. I recommend a preventative maintenance schedule where nozzles are inspected every 3,000 to 5,000 operating hours. Look for suppliers that provide easy-to-clean designs or modular tips that allow for quick replacement without dismantling the entire burner assembly.

Cross-Border Procurement Strategy for Boiler Components

How can I mitigate the risks of receiving sub-standard industrial components?

To ensure quality, always request a Material Test Report (MTR) and a Certificate of Conformity (CoC) before shipment. For large orders, engage a third-party inspection service (like SGS or Intertek) to perform a visual and dimensional check at the factory. What are the best practices for negotiating with specialized industrial suppliers?

Focus on Total Cost of Ownership (TCO) rather than just the unit price. Negotiate for spare parts kits to be included in the initial bulk order. Ask for tiered pricing based on annual volume commitments; for instance, a 15-20% discount is often achievable when moving from sample quantities to batches of 500+ units. Ensure the contract specifies warranty terms of at least 12 months against manufacturing defects.

What shipping and logistics precautions should be taken for precision nozzles?

Boiler nozzles are precision instruments; even minor scratches on the orifice can ruin the spray pattern. Insist on vacuum-sealed anti-rust packaging and individual protective caps for each nozzle tip. For international transit, use reinforced double-walled corrugated boxes with shock-absorbing foam inserts. Ensure the Incoterms (e.g., DAP or CIF) are clearly defined in the Proforma Invoice to avoid hidden port charges or customs clearance delays.

How do I ensure transaction security when dealing with high-value industrial orders?

Utilize secure payment methods such as Letters of Credit (L/C) for large-scale industrial contracts or Escrow-based payment services provided by reputable B2B platforms. Avoid direct wire transfers to private accounts. Always verify that the beneficiary bank account name matches the company name on the business license and the Made-in-China.com supplier profile to prevent payment fraud.
